About Wrongful Termination Law in Sanaa, Yemen

Wrongful termination in Sanaa, Yemen refers to the illegal dismissal of an employee from their job. This can happen for various reasons, such as discrimination, retaliation, or violation of labor laws. If you believe you have been wrongfully terminated, it is essential to seek legal advice to protect your rights.

Local Laws Overview

In Sanaa, Yemen, the labor law protects employees from wrongful termination. Employees cannot be dismissed based on their race, gender, religion, or any other discriminatory factor. The law also outlines procedures for termination, such as giving notice or compensation to the employee.

Frequently Asked Questions

What qualifies as wrongful termination in Sanaa, Yemen?

Wrongful termination in Sanaa, Yemen can include dismissal based on discrimination, retaliation, violation of labor laws, or without following proper termination procedures.

How can I prove wrongful termination?

You can prove wrongful termination by providing evidence such as emails, witness statements, performance evaluations, or any other documentation that supports your claim.

What remedies are available for wrongful termination in Sanaa, Yemen?

Remedies for wrongful termination in Sanaa, Yemen may include reinstatement, back pay, compensation for damages, or other forms of relief as determined by the court.

Is there a time limit to file a wrongful termination claim in Sanaa, Yemen?

Yes, there is a limitation period to file a wrongful termination claim in Sanaa, Yemen. It is advisable to seek legal advice promptly to ensure you meet the deadline.
